Many problems have been encountered in attempts to identify the musical emotional structure of sounds in gaming and on the internet. The search has been unfinished due to the uncertainty about composite waveforms. The survey method by playing typical music playing and listening to respondents directly. At the introduction to the study, relative areas were defined in a range of topics with “Color music” matching colors to visible light and the traditional general term of music emotions. At the core of research are the structures of major and minor in music interval structure, which were correlated with the emotions “happy” and “sad” mood in typical music. Therefore, the statistical method was chosen with 104 respondents to confirm the different emotions between major and minor interval. At the survey stage, simple questions were given to respondents to determine whether the music was “happy or sad” and respondents describe the density of the emotions between major and minor chord. Finally the results showed no differences from typical music introductions. Following from the results of this study, “happy and sad” modes, matching colors to musical pitches, rainbow scales, harmonies and composition sound art-work will be continued.
